Disability Shower Installation in Bradenton, FL
Disability shower installation services focus on creating accessible and safe bathing spaces for individuals with mobility challenges or disabilities. These projects typically involve replacing existing showers with barrier-free designs, installing walk-in or roll-in showers, and adding features such as grab bars, seating, and non-slip flooring. Property owners often seek these services to improve independence and safety in the bathroom, ensuring that the shower area accommodates specific needs and complies with personal preferences or accessibility standards.
Before requesting disability shower installation, property owners should consider the existing bathroom layout, the specific mobility requirements of the user, and any preferences for features or finishes. It’s helpful to understand the dimensions available for the new shower, the types of assistive devices that may be used, and whether modifications to plumbing or electrical systems are necessary. Clear communication about these details can help ensure the installation meets the desired safety, functionality, and aesthetic goals.

Disability Shower Installation Questions
What types of disability showers are available for installation? There are various options including walk-in showers, roll-in showers, and shower seats designed to enhance safety and accessibility.
What should property owners consider before installing a disability shower? It's important to evaluate space requirements, existing bathroom layout, and specific accessibility needs to choose the right shower setup.
Can a disability shower be added to an existing bathroom? Yes, many installations are done within existing bathrooms, with modifications made to accommodate accessibility features.
What are common features included in disability shower installations? Features often include grab bars, non-slip flooring, low thresholds, and adjustable shower heads for ease of use and safety.
